Chapter I: Sea Monsters
Season 1Episode 160 min

Chapter I: Sea Monsters

After discovering Nazaré, Portugal's monstrous swells, pro surfer Garrett McNamara sets out to achieve his dream of riding a 100-foot wave.

Chapter II: We're Not Surfers
Season 1Episode 260 min

Chapter II: We're Not Surfers

In 2011, just as the largest swell of the season approaches, the McNamaras and their team reconvene in Nazaré, where they kick preparations into high gear to prepare for their upcoming attempt at making history. Then, despite some unexpected hurdles, Garrett catches a wave that forever changes him, the small seaside town, and the legacy of the sport.

Chapter III: Mavericks
Season 1Episode 360 min

Chapter III: Mavericks

A few days after his historic ride, Garrett is visited by his mother, whose presence prompts an exploration into his highly unconventional and turbulent childhood. In 2013, a group of Brazilians arrive in Nazaré, but their failure to heed Garrett's safety advice results in a near-fatal accident. In 2017, Garrett's appearance at a big wave competition takes a devasting turn.

Chapter IV: Dancing With God
Season 1Episode 460 min

Chapter IV: Dancing With God

In 2017, prominent surfers flock to Nazaré for its largest swell to date and while one pro sets a new world record, Andrew Cotton suffers a devastating wipeout. In 2019, after rallying through a back-to-back concussion and broken foot, Garrett struggles with determining whether he's mentally ready to get back in the water.

Chapter V: The Circus
Season 1Episode 560 min

Chapter V: The Circus

After the World Surf League announces that Nazare will host an upcoming big wave competition, athletes from around the globe arrive to participate in the tournament. But as the event grows in scope, so do Garrett's concerns over the proposed safety protocols. Later, the world-class surfers prepare for some of the largest, most unpredictable waves they've ever seen.

Chapter VI: More Than Just a Wipeout
Season 1Episode 660 min

Chapter VI: More Than Just a Wipeout

In front of thousands of spectators, the WSL's Tow Surfing Challenge comes to an abrupt end after one competitor suffers a serious injury. As the surfers process the news, they reflect on their tremendous love, fear, and awe of their unpredictable sport. Later, after sitting out the contest, Garrett puts his own injuries behind him and gets back in the water.
